Most VR cricket bat tracking problems are not a broken game. They are a loose controller, a hidden camera, or a grip profile that was saved at the wrong angle.

Fix the hardware first. Then fix the room. Then touch iB Cricket settings. If you start by turning bowling speed up and down, you will hide the real fault.
This guide is for Meta Quest 3 and Quest 3s. The same checks help on Quest 2, but do not put a Quest 2 bat on a newer headset and expect clean tracking.
Run this checklist first
Work from the top. Stop when the bat starts behaving.
- Is the right controller in the bat?
- Does the black tracking part face you in your stance?
- Does the controller rattle when you shake the handle?
- Are all straps on?
- Is the Guardian drawn for a swing, not a standing circle?
- Is the room lit well enough for the cameras?
- Did you save the iB Cricket grip profile against the bat shoulders?
- Are you using a bat made for Quest 3 / 3s, not Quest 2?
If the controller rattles, do not keep playing. Tracking cannot stay true on a moving mount.
What “bad tracking” usually looks like
People use one phrase for several faults. Separate them.
Wobble
The virtual bat shakes, rolls, or changes face while your hands feel still. This is almost always movement inside the handle.
Delayed shots
You swing on time, but the game shows the shot late. This can be tracking loss, a twisted profile, or bowling that is simply quicker than your current timing.
Bat facing the wrong way
The handle in your hands looks normal. The in-game bat is open, closed, upside down, or pointing off to the side.
The bat vanishes on the backswing
The headset loses sight of the controller, then finds it again after the shot. That is occlusion or a bad Guardian.
Treat those as different jobs. One setting change will not fix all four.
Fix wobble before anything else
Take the headset off.
- Undo the straps.
- Slide the right controller out.
- Put it back in so it sits flush.
- Lock it.
- Add the bat strap and the controller strap.
- Shake the handle hard.

Point the tracking ring the right way
When you take stance, the black tracking part of the controller should face you. It sits at the back of the bat, not down the pitch.
If that ring points at the bowler, Quest 3 and 3s can lose the controller at the top of the backlift. The shot then appears late, or the blade jumps.
This is the first thing to check if tracking was fine on Quest 2 and fell apart after an upgrade.
Refit the controller. Then calibrate again. Do not only twist the in-game profile and hope.
Recalibrate the grip in iB Cricket
A locked mount is not enough. The game still needs the real handle and the virtual bat to match.
- Open iB Cricket.
- Go to Settings.
- Open Bat settings.
- Choose Adjust bat grip.
- Edit one profile.
- Line up the shoulders of the real bat with the virtual bat.
- Keep the bat still and press the trigger.
Do not only match the top of the handle. If the shoulders are off, every drive looks like an edge.
After you save, lift the headset and check from the side. If the virtual bat is still open or closed, edit the same profile. Do not start a match.

Delayed shots: tracking or timing?
Not every late shot is a tracking bug.
Ask this: did the virtual bat move with your hands, but the ball beat you? That is timing. Slow the bowling down in Practice Nets.
Ask this instead: did the virtual bat lag, freeze, or flip after you had already swung? That is tracking.
Useful tells:
- Tracking: the blade face changes after the swing starts
- Tracking: the bat looks fine until the backlift, then jumps
- Timing: the bat looks true, but you are early or late on pace
- Timing: blocks feel normal and only the slog looks late
Change one variable. First lock the controller. Then redraw the grip profile. Then change bowling speed.
Stop the headset losing the bat
Quest cameras need to see the controller. Help them.
- Do not cover the tracking ring with extra plastic, tape, or a thick glove trick
- Stand in the middle of the Guardian, not against a wall
- Use normal indoor light. Avoid a pitch-dark room and hard sunlight on one side
- Keep spare strap ends away from the cameras
- Do not swing so close to a sofa that the headset sees furniture instead of the controller
If the Guardian grid flashes at the top of every shot, the boundary is too small. Redraw it in Roomscale. Cricket needs follow-through space.
Room and Guardian faults that look like bat faults
Before you blame iB Cricket, check the space.
- A lamp at bat height
- A ceiling fan in the backlift
- A dark glossy TV that confuses the cameras
- A standing-only Guardian
- Someone walking through the boundary

Wrong-generation bats create “mystery” tracking issues
If you upgraded the headset and kept the old handle, start there.
A Quest 2 bat can accept a Quest 3 controller and still hide sensors or leave a gap. The game then looks random: fine for two balls, then suddenly late.
Do not keep tightening a lock made for a different controller. Buy the matching bat, then calibrate that one.
A 10-ball test that isolates the fault
Go to Practice Nets. Use medium pace. Do not slog.
- Leave two balls and watch the virtual bat. It should stay still.
- Block two balls. The face should not roll on its own.
- Play two straight pushes. Contact should match your hands.
- Take one slow backlift and stop. The bat should not vanish.
- Play two normal drives only if the first eight balls looked true.
If the bat fails on the leave, it is setup. If it only fails when you swing hard, check lock tightness, straps, and nearby walls.
What not to do
- Do not smash the next ball harder “to force tracking”
- Do not stack five setting changes at once
- Do not cover the controller in extra wraps
- Do not use Stationary Guardian for batting
- Do not keep a rattling mount in play

Why does my VR cricket bat lose tracking on Quest 3?
The usual causes are a hidden tracking ring, a loose mount, or a Quest 2 bat on a Quest 3 controller.
Why are my shots delayed?
If the virtual bat lags or jumps, fix tracking. If the bat looks true and the ball beats you, slow the bowling down.
Why does the in-game bat face the wrong way?
The controller is in backwards, or the grip profile was saved against the handle instead of the bat shoulders. Refit, then recalibrate.
Can lighting affect VR cricket bat tracking?
Yes. Very dark rooms and harsh sunlight both make it harder for the headset to see the controller.
